1. Vehicle dynamics modelling of electromagnetic suspensions for MAGLEV applications
University essay from KTH/Väg- och spårfordon samt konceptuell fordonsdesignAbstract : MAGnetic LEVitation Guidance System (MAGLEV) technology was commercially introduced relatively recently in the guided transport field. It is based on removing the wheels and rails of classic railway systems and supporting and guiding the train with magnets and magnetic forces instead. READ MORE

4. Parametric Studies of Train-Track-Bridge Interaction : An evaluation of the dynamic amplification due to track irregularities for freight transport
University essay from KTH/Bro- och stålbyggnadAbstract : In this thesis a train-track-bridge interaction (TTBI) model is developed in order to study the dynamic amplification from track irregularities on railway bridges traversed by freight trains. These simulations are of great importance since rail freight transport is expected to increase in order to meet the climate goals. READ MORE
